<div class="def">
<div class="term-def-header">Language Resolution</div>
<div>
<dfn data-lt="language resolution">Language Resolution</dfn> is the process of determining and ordering the
values associated with a given subject-predicate pair, prioritizing the preferred or most relevant language
value for display.
</div>
</div>
<div class="def">
<div class="term-def-header">Label Resolution</div>
<div>
<dfn data-lt="label resolution">Label Resolution</dfn> is the process of selecting the most appropriate
display label for an RDF resource, or generating a fallback value when no suitable value exists. It
applies to both value nodes and properties identified by <code>sh:path</code>, the latter of which is commonly used to label form elements.

The process includes <a>language resolution</a> and considers labeling-related annotations from the
<a>shapes graph</a>, <a>data graph</a>, application environment, and user preferences, to determine the best label for UI presentation.
</div>
</div>
<div class="def">
<div class="term-def-header">Property UI Component</div>
<div>
A <dfn data-lt="property ui component">Property UI Component</dfn> is a combination of <a>constraints</a>
across multiple <a>property shapes</a> that share the same <a>property path</a>, <a>focus node</a>, and
<a>value nodes</a>. It represents a single field (e.g., a text input, a dropdown) in a form.
</div>
</div>
<div class="def">
<div class="term-def-header">Node UI Component</div>
<div>
A <dfn data-lt="node ui component">Node UI Component</dfn> is generated from a single <a>focus node</a>,
typically containing one or more <a>property UI components</a>. It is often derived from one or more
<a>node shapes</a> that apply to the <a>focus node</a>.
</div>
</div>
<div class="def">
<div class="term-def-header">SHACL Renderer</div>
<div>
A <dfn data-lt="shacl Renderer">SHACL Renderer</dfn> is a piece of software that processes SHACL
<a>shapes</a> and data to dynamically generate a form. A UI that represents the data is generated from one
or more <a>node UI components</a>. The SHACL renderer may add additional UI elements, such as a submit
button to save changes, a button to toggle between edit and view mode, selectors for <a>focus node</a> and
<a>node shape</a>, or messages from the <a>validation report</a>.
